Core Viewpoint - Six securities firms reported strong growth in both revenue and net profit for Q1 2025, indicating a robust performance in the industry [2][4][7]. Group 1: Financial Performance - CICC achieved revenue of 5.721 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 47.69%, and a net profit of 2.042 billion yuan, up 64.85% [3][4]. - China Merchants Securities reported revenue of 4.713 billion yuan, a 9.64% increase, and a net profit of 2.308 billion yuan, up 6.97% [3][5]. - Changjiang Securities saw significant growth with revenue of 2.514 billion yuan, an 88.81% increase, and a net profit of 980 million yuan, up 143.76% [3][5]. - Guoyuan Securities reported revenue of 1.519 billion yuan, a 38.37% increase, and a net profit of 641 million yuan, up 38.40% [3][6]. - Huazhong Securities achieved revenue of 1.431 billion yuan, a 72.02% increase, and a net profit of 525 million yuan, up 87.79% [3][5]. - Great Wall Securities reported revenue of 1.277 billion yuan, a 41.02% increase, and a net profit of 605 million yuan, up 71.56% [3][5]. Group 2: Industry Trends - The growth in performance is attributed to increased brokerage and investment banking activities, supported by a rise in new A-share accounts [7][9]. - In March 2025, new A-share accounts reached 3.0655 million, a 26.67% increase compared to March 2024 [7]. - The total number of new accounts for Q1 2025 was 7.4714 million, a 31.74% increase year-on-year [7][8]. - Analysts believe that the capital market's recovery since September 2024 has led to increased trading activity, contributing to the strong performance of securities firms [9].
